The Server Administrator Remote Access MIB ( filename dcs3rmt.mib ) provides in-band information
about remote access hardware that may be present in your system.
The Server Administrator Remote Access MIB structures its MIB objects into groups of scalar objects or
MIB tables that provide related information. Table below describes each Server Administrator Remote
Access MIB group and lists the MIB group number assigned to the MIB group. The Server Administrator
Remote Access MIB groups are identified by the SNMP OID 1.3.6.1.4.1.674.10892.1.<MIB group number>
where <MIB group number> is the MIB group number assigned to the MIB group. See the relevant section
for more information about the MIB objects defined in a MIB group.

Dell Remote Access Controller Out-of-Band MIB
The Dell Remote Access Controller Out-of-Band MIB (filename DELL-RAC-MIB.txt) provides
management data that allows you to monitor the Chassis Management Controller. This MIB also contains
information on RAC legacy alerting. The following table describes each Dell RAC Out-of-Band group and
lists the MIB group number assigned to the MIB group. See the relevant section for more information
about the MIB objects defined in a MIB group.
